# Opening-section pairs

❌ Never (us-first):

About Us: With over a decade of combined experience, our team delivers best-in-class digital transformation solutions to clients across industries.

✅ House style (them-first):

The problem. Your checkout abandonment sits at 71% — 11 points above your category median — and your team traced most drop-offs to the forced account-creation step. You told us: "we lose them at the login wall."

# Scope exclusion patterns

✅ Every scope section carries three lists:

markdown
### Included
- Checkout flow redesign (5 screens) with two revision rounds
- A/B test setup and 4-week measurement

### Not included
- Payment-provider migration or new payment methods
- Copywriting beyond the checkout screens
- Changes to the mobile app (web only)

### Available separately
- Post-launch conversion monitoring: $2k/mo

❌ Never: an "Included" list alone — the client's imagination writes the other two lists, in their favor.

# Complete worked example (condensed)

❌ Bad version:

Proposal for Services

About us: [4 paragraphs of credentials and logos] Our approach: We will conduct a discovery phase, followed by design sprints, followed by implementation and QA. Deliverables include wireframes, design system tokens, and up to 40 hours of development. Investment: $27,400. We're excited about the opportunity and look forward to hearing from you!

✅ House-style version:

# Cutting checkout abandonment at Northshoe

The problem. Checkout abandonment is 71% against a 60% category median; your analytics show the account-creation step loses half of them. Every point of abandonment is ≈$9k/mo in lost orders at current traffic.

The outcome. Guest checkout live in 6 weeks; target abandonment ≤63% within 60 days of launch, measured by your own GA4 funnel — worth ≈$70k/yr at the low end.

How. Week 1–2 flow redesign (5 screens, 2 revision rounds); week 3–5 build behind a feature flag; week 6 A/B rollout at 50%.

Scope. Included / Not included / Available separately: [three lists]

Investment. Essential $18k · Standard $27k (recommended) · Premium $41k. Standard adds the A/B measurement that turns the launch into evidence; Premium adds the mobile app.

Assumptions. GA4 access by day 2; feature-flag infra exists (it does — LaunchDarkly). If either slips, timeline moves day-for-day.

Proof. Same intervention at Nordica: 71% → 58% in 9 weeks (case attached).

Next step. Countersign by Aug 22 to hold the Sept 2 start. Pricing valid until Aug 29.

# Gotchas

  • Effort listed in hours invites hourly negotiation; sell deliverables and outcomes, keep hours internal.
  • "Investment" vs "cost" — use "investment" only when an ROI number backs it; otherwise it reads as spin.
  • Unpriced Premium tier ("contact us") breaks the anchor; price all tiers.
  • Case studies without numbers are decoration; every proof point carries a metric and a timeframe.
  • The expiry date you don't enforce trains clients to ignore the next one. Pick a date you'll honor.
